These llimits Are designed to provide reasonable protection against radio frequency Interference in a residential installation. This equipment generates, uses And can radiate radio frequency energy. If not installed and used in Accordance with the instructions, it may cause interference to radio Communications. However,there is no guarantee that interference will Not occur in a particular installation. If this equipment does cause Interference to radio or television reception(this can be determined by Turning this equipment off and on), the user is encouraged to try to Correct the interference by one or more of the following measures: •Reorient or relocate the receiving antenna. •Increase the separation between the equipment and receiver. •Connect the equipment to an outlet on a circuit different from that to which the receiver is connected. CAUTION TO THE USER: The Federal Communications Commission warns that changes or Modifications to the unit not expressly approved by the party responsible For compliance could void the user’s authority to operate the equipment. If necessary, the user should contact the dealer or an experienced Radio/television technician for additional suggestions. The usermay find The Federal Communications Commission booklet, How to Identify and Resolve Radio-TV Interference Problems, helpful. This booklet is Available from the U.S.Government Printing Office, Washington, D.C., Stock No.004-000-00345-4. NOTICE OF COMPLIANCE WITH CANADIAN INTERFERENCE-CAUSING EQUIPMENT REGULATIONS INTRODUCTION i SAFETY INSTRUCTIONS INTRODUCTION ■Handling Due to its fragile glass panel, this monitor must be handled with Caution and not be exposed to impact or shock. Never touch the display area or rub it with a hard object or tool, as the Panel is easily scratched. ■Cleaning The display area is sensitive to scratching. Do not use ketone-type Cleaners(i.e.acetone),ethyl alcohol, toluene, ethyl acid or methyl Chloride to clean the panel. Doing so may result in permanent damage. Water, IPA(Iso Prophyl Alcohol) and Hexane are safe cleaners. Do not allow oil or water to penetrate the display, this will cause Staining and discoloration. Avoid getting food particles and fingerprints on the display area at all Times. ■Storage Store the monitor in a dark place away from sunlight and ultraviolet (UV)radiation, this may cause air bubbles to develop within the glass panel. Do not store the display in temperatures higher than 40°C/104°F or Humidity greater than 90%. Avoid condensation. iii SAFETY INSTRUCTIONS INTRODUCTION ■Caution 1. Do not open any covers on the monitor. No user serviceable parts are inside. 2. In an emergency, disconnect the AC power plug. 3. To avoid electrical shock, disconnect the power cord from the monitor before connecting the signal cable to the computer. 4. Keep away from liquids and flame. Do not immerse this monitor in water or any other liquid. Do not use this device in excessively hot conditions. 5. Handle the power cord with care. Do not bend the power cord excessively or place heavy objects on it. Do not use a damaged power cord, doing so can result in fire or electrical shock hazards. When disconnecting the power cord, always grasp the plug, not the cord. 6. The liquid crystals in the display panel contain several irritants. If the panel is damaged or broken, do not allow the liquid to come in contact with skin, eyes, or mouth. If you come in contact with the liquid, flush the affected area with running water for at least 15minutes, then consult a doctor. 7. Handle this monitor with care when moving it. When lifting the monitor, support it with one hand holding the stand, and one hand holding the LCD screen. 8. Always disconnect the power cord when moving this monitor. 9.
